Transaction ec140809e38e62f0aea7ad275c89e1a4e424f94fa2c4bf1f17a51de0dbd26f59
1 Input
1 Output
-
ec140809e38e62f0aea7ad275c89e1a4e424f94fa2c4bf1f17a51de0dbd26f59:0
- value
- 28697854
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ed73bc1c201d1dc1e394c54b4b487d06cb3d8a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L3i1MwnfBXfk5EwSioEjUpAgEhkG3gcaY